Fine motor skills

At what point did your LOs fine motor skills really begin to emerge? Ds has been a bit ahead with all his large motor skills, but is still not fairly interested in holding objects for extended periods of time, or playing with things on his jumperoo. For instance, he will hold his sofie for a minute or oball then lose interest and drop it. We will give his a teether, and he will do the same/ not want to put it in his mouth. Is this about right for a 20 wk old? I am not really concerned as he grabs, pulls, etc, just wondering when the skill of playing with toys and other objects really develops.
